About this home

Welcome home to 706 Oceanhill Drive! Less than 2 miles from the beach, this California casa offers an incredible opportunity. Rarely available, the original floorplan was expanded to include 3 generously sized bedrooms on the second level, 2.5 bathrooms, a 2-car attached garage with additional storage, a spacious rear yard with hook ups for an above ground spa, plus a large balcony off the primary bedroom suite. Natural light flows seamlessly into the home with vaulted ceilings in the living room and on the second level, and upgraded windows throughout. Gather in the open concept kitchen, or around the gas fireplace in the great room, perfect for entertaining between the two adjacent spaces. Abundant storage and details throughout, including double closets in the primary bedroom, office nook, upgraded bathrooms, and authentic bamboo flooring. Enjoy an afternoon cocktail on your front porch, or take the party out back where you can grill and watch the game on your outdoor TV at the same time. If energy efficiency is a priority, you’re all set with leased solar and 220V installed in the garage, where charging should be no problem! Quiet interior location, this home sits higher than others on the street, and even offers peek-a-boo mountain views from the primary bedroom. Multiple parks within walking distance make it pet friendly as well! Easy access to Beach Blvd for shopping, dining at Pacific City, a short stroll to Main Street, or a leisurely bike ride to the beach, the location is absolutely perfect.
